Understanding Fire Hoses
Fire hoses are essential tools used by firefighters to transport water from a hydrant or water source to the fire. They are designed to withstand high pressure and are made from durable materials to ensure that they can deliver water efficiently and effectively. The characteristics of fire hoses vary significantly based on their intended use. Common types include attack hoses, supply hoses, and booster hoses, each designed for different firefighting scenarios.
Attack Hoses are typically smaller in diameter and are used for delivering water directly to the fire. They are flexible and manageable, allowing firefighters to maneuver into tight spaces. Supply Hoses, on the other hand, have a larger diameter and are used to transport large volumes of water from a hydrant to the fire engine. Booster Hoses are lightweight, high-pressure hoses that are often used in industrial or commercial situations.
Importance of Quality
When shopping for fire hoses, quality should be your utmost priority. Low-quality hoses may fail under pressure, leading to disastrous consequences during a fire emergency. Look for hoses that comply with safety standards and regulations, such as those set by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) or Underwriters Laboratories (UL). These standards ensure that the hoses have been tested for durability, resistance to abrasion, and overall performance.
Buying the Right Fire Hose
If you're in the market for fire hoses, consider the following factors to make an informed purchase
1. Intended Use Determine how you plan to use the fire hose. Are you purchasing for personal safety, for a community fire department, or for industrial use? Each scenario may require different specifications.
2. Length and Diameter Fire hoses come in various lengths, typically ranging from 25 to 100 feet, and diameters, commonly from 1 to 5 inches. Choose a length that allows you to reach potential fire areas, and select a diameter that suits the water flow needed.
3. Material Most fire hoses are made of synthetic materials such as nylon or polyester, which provide strength and flexibility. Ensure the hoses have protective coatings to resist wear and tear over time.
4. Accessories Consider whether you need additional accessories such as nozzles, couplings, and storage options. These can enhance the effectiveness of your fire hose and improve your firefighting capabilities.
